Transaction daa07f943bc20d0060723ec3ff76c7a36c08e7de746fda45dae5bc7242d44e2f
2 Input
1 Outputs
- daa07f943bc20d0060723ec3ff76c7a36c08e7de746fda45dae5bc7242d44e2f:0
value 81497
address 1EFY52bW7BGZWzYW1coTFaeuH6MmEZRfx5